Summary:PROBLEM TO BE SOLVED: To provide a motion detector that can detect the presence of an object and the presence of flow at all times by arranging a Doppler type sensor and a receiver on both sides of a carrier path, opposedly with specified angle difference. SOLUTION: A Doppler movement detector 10 and a receiver 20 are opposedly arranged on a carrier path. Speed detecting transmit wave is transmitted from the Doppler movement detector 10, and if an object 30 for measurement exists, its reflected wave is detected by the Doppler movement detector 10 to detect the object 30 for measurement, and if no object for measurement 30 exists, the speed detecting transmit wave directly reaches the receiver 20 so as to discriminate nonpresence of the object 30 for measurement.
